ABSTRACT:
Dispersions of finely divided particulate solids in an organic liquid in which the solids are insoluble are stabilized by the addition of a polymeric dispersant having a degree of polymerization of about 10 to 100. An example of the polymeric dispersant is an interpolymer of styrene, maleic anhydride and a vinyl benzyl ether of ethoxylated nonyl phenol.
